What Is Climate-Smart Gardening: Strategies To Build A Resilient Garden To Combat Climate Change

These simple gardening techniques can significantly reduce emissions, save water, and help sequester more carbon in soil and plants.

Climate-smart gardening follows a set of strategies that can make your garden or yard more durable in extreme weather conditions while mitigating the adverse impact of your gardening activities on the climate.

There are multiple approaches to climate-savvy gardening—using organic and sustainable gardening practices that prioritise the conservation of soil, pollinators, and biodiversity. In addition, you may focus on the reduction of plastic waste, try rainwater harvesting and up-cycle materials. Read on to explore eight strategies that can help you build a climate-smart garden.

Avoid tilling to sequester carbon.

Currently, the “no-tilling” approach is one of the biggest gardening trends. It is an incredible strategy that promotes better soil health and reduces the adverse impact of gardening on the climate.

For decades, vegetable cultivators had been tilling the soil every year, to prepare the solid for harvest. However, recent studies have revealed that tilling ruins the soil’s natural structure, increases the germination of weed seeds, and hampers creatures that live in soil—like earthworms. Tilling also releases stored carbon in the atmosphere. By following the no-dig approach, you can grow healthy plants, maintain good soil health, and save the environment.

Mulch the soil

Mulching the soil using organic materials is one of the key elements of climate-smart gardening. It benefits the environment in several ways—by minimising soil erosion, suppressing the growth of weeds, nourishing the soil, and retaining moisture.

Focus on biodiversity

Practice biodiversity by growing different plant species to attract birds, butterflies, bees and other wildlife. Your focus should be on growing plant species that are native to your region, and it is also essential to invest in some plants that bear flowers from spring through autumn.

The pollinators require a persistent source of pollen and nectar, and if your garden lacks a progression of flowers, they will stop frequenting your foliage.

Eliminate the use of pesticides.

A climate-smart garden should not use pesticides—be it organic or chemical. Instead, you should focus on adopting techniques that naturally repel pests. You should buy pest-resistant and native plants—and encourage the growth of nesting birds that can help solve the pest problem.

Practice rainwater harvesting

During heavy downpours, you should practise rainwater harvesting to collect fresh water in barrels. You can use this water in your drip irrigation system which is more energy efficient and sustainable than conventional sprinklers.

Use manual gardening tools.

Garden and lawn equipment like leaf blowers and lawn mowers are responsible for emitting gasoline into the atmosphere. Your climate-smart garden could operate on manual tools instead. Using reel mowers, pitchforks, and trowels calls for more manual labour than their fuel-powered alternatives, but are safe for the environment.

Encourage wildlife

You can install a small water feature to attract toads, newts and frogs to your yard. The water in the sunken basin or pond can also be utilised by birds and squirrels. In addition, allow deadwood and leaves to remain littered in your garden instead of aiming to keep the space spick and span—it will encourage bugs and little animals to pay frequent visits. 

Embrace rewilding

Rewilding is a gardening approach that aims at the restoration of yards to build a more uncultivated and natural gardening patch. All you have to do is—allow nature to do its thing, and you can offer a helping hand by sowing native species of shrubs, perennials, and trees.

Try to limit mowing your lawn to protect your grass, and it will help create an inviting habitat for wildlife and insects.
